diff --git a/packages-user/client-modules/src/render/components/tip.tsx b/packages-user/client-modules/src/render/components/tip.tsx index 93ec101..97310eb 100644 --- a/packages-user/client-modules/src/render/components/tip.tsx +++ b/packages-user/client-modules/src/render/components/tip.tsx @@ -92,7 +92,8 @@ export const Tip = defineComponent((props, { expose }) => { const num = texture.idNumberMap[iconId]; iconNum.value = num; } else { - iconNum.value = iconId; + // 样板竟然会传 null 进来,然后报错 + iconNum.value = iconId ?? 0; } text.value = core.replaceText(tipText); alpha.set(0, 0);